Default transfer PT 8.1 to 10 on new iMac

Years ago, I installed PT 7 from a disc. Throughout the years, I upgraded to PT 8.1 by downloading via Digidesign's site. I now want to upgrade to PT 10, but want it installed on a new iMac. Is there a way for me to upgrade to Pro Tools 10 Upgrade/Crossgrade onto my new computer? If so, can you send me a link that explain how it's done? Or do I have to buy it new?

iMac 21.5-inch 2.5GHz Quad-Core Intel Core i5, O/S Lion, 16G ram

I went from PT 7.x on a G5 iMac to PT10 on a new iMac running Lion.

I bought my iMac and PT10 upgrade from Guitar Center. That purchase of the upgrade from PT 8 and lower now costs $399.

Since the software is delivered over the internet, all I got for my $$ was a code that was printed on my Guitar Center receipt. That code enabled me to download PT10 from the Avid site.

To do this, you have to have an account at Avid, where it is established that you are a current owner of a lower version of LE.

Anyhoo, it is kind of weird compared to the old way of getting a box with a disc in it, but it works.

AH, I noticed upon better reading that you have downloaded the software before. This should be familiar for you-

The main thing is that you don't need to have a previous version of Protools installed on the new Mac, because Protools 10 is a full installer. You get the same thing as if you bought a full version, only you pay less because it's a crossgrade.

So you just download PT10 to your new Mac and install it.
